Output 59d88bfc8ce1cc6415f5cc20a6169401d843c4456840365260f6b87711066315:1

value
423574
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1506da2cea6eb4d6ec1877d6c7964773685e20c5 OP_EQUALVERIFY OP_CHECKSIG
address
12vBQ8baBqXUxr9x5GRSqiWYUezUCUy87q
transaction
59d88bfc8ce1cc6415f5cc20a6169401d843c4456840365260f6b87711066315
spent
true